Sultana Pudding.
- Ingredients—1 lb. of flour.
- ½ lb. of finely-chopped suet.
- ¼ lb. of sultanas.
- ¼ lb. of castor sugar; or, three ounces of moist sugar.
- 2 oz. of candied peel.
- The grated rind of a lemon.
- A pinch of salt.
- 1 egg.
- A little milk.
Method.—Rub the sultanas in flour and pick off the stalks.
Cut the candied peel in small pieces.
Put all the dry ingredients into a basin, and mix with the egg, well beaten, and a little milk.
Boil in a basin or cloth three hours.
